Home School Programs
All programs meet and/or exceed the State of Ohio's educational content standards in science, math and social studies and are geared to the age level of your children. We also fulfill the Physical Education content required by the home school curriculum. Programs are offered at three YMCA branches. Camp Y-Noah
Camp Y-Noah provides home school programs including, Mountain Biking, Horseback Riding, Digital Photography, Guitar Lessons, Archery and Canoeing, just to name a few. We also offer a variety of hands-on, science-based, classes that are fun, challenging and follow State guidelines for Education.

Nordonia Hills YMCA
Students 6-13 years of age are engaged in several unique classes including: backcountry cooking, nature art, low ropes challenge course, watershed studies, archery, bird studies, outdoor living skills and more. Nordonia Hills can accommodate field trips for home school groups and co-ops that are interested in a group outing.
